10 Temmuz 2010, CUMARTESİ
Neden easy_install pip üzerinde kullanmak?
tweet okur:
Tabii easy_install kullanmayın. karşısında kendini bıçaklama gibi. Pip kullanın.
Neden easy_install pip üzerinde kullanmak? fault lie with PyPI and package authors mostly değil mi? Eğer bir yazar saçmalığı kaynak tar (örn: eksik dosyalar yok setup.py) PyPİ için yükler ise, o zaman her ikisi de pip ve easy_install başarısız olur. Kozmetik farklar dışında, neden Python insanlar (yukarıdaki tweet gibi) gibi görünüyorgüçlüeasy_install pip üzerinde iyilik?
(Hadi topluluğu tarafından tutulan itibaren Dağıtmak easy_install paketi) bahsediyoruz varsayalım
CEVAP
10 Temmuz 2010, CUMARTESİ
Ian Bicking itibaren kendi introduction to pip:
pip ilk olarak aşağıdaki şekillerde easy_install geliştirmek için yazılmıştır
- Tüm paketleri yüklemeden önce yüklenir. Kısmen tamamlanmış olan yükleme sonucu meydana gelmez.
- Bakım konsolda kullanışlı çıktı sunmak için alınır.
- Eylemler için nedenler takip ediyordu. Eğer bir paket yüklü değilse örneğin, pip paketi gerekli olduğunu neden izleyebilir.
- Hata iletileri yararlı olmalıdır.
- Kod nispeten kısa ve kaynaşmış, daha kolay program aracılığıyla bir kullanım sağlıyor.
- Paketleri yumurta arşiv olarak yüklü olmasına gerek yok, düz yüklenebilir yumurta meta tutarken ().
- Diğer sürüm kontrol sistemleri (Gıt, Mercurial ve Çarşı için yerel destek
- Paketleri kaldırma.
- Basit gereksinimleri sabit kümeleri tanımlamak ve güvenilir bir şekilde paketleri bir dizi üretmek için.
Bunu Paylaş:
Neden't varsa PyPy 6.3 kat daha h...
Neden memset üzerinde bzero kullanmak?...
Neden Google App Engine üzerinde Djang...
Neden Python easy_install benim Mac üz...
Neden fonksiyonları üzerinde funktorla...